WebHistological lesions were observed in the kidneys of 77 (32.5%) of 237 rabbits which were either found dead or were killed because they were unwell, and in 19 (25%) of 75 apparently healthy adult rabbits. Lesions associated with an infectious process such as renal abscesses, staphylococcal nephritis, pyelonephritis and pyelitis were the ... WebSep 16, 2006 · Kidney disease may cause a change in the way calcium is excreted or handled. A variety of diseases can affect the kidneys, including parasitic, infectious and non-infectious. Bladder disease may cause a change in the lining of the bladder, causing calcium carbonate to accumulate and form stones or sludge. WebSome rabbits live with E. cuniculi for their whole lives and never have any signs of disease. If your rabbit has mild symptoms, treatment can help your rabbit make a full recovery. Unfortunately with more serious symptoms even after treatment your rabbit may continue to have problems, for example kidney disease or a permanent head tilt.
